The IXFH120N20P follows the standard pin configuration for a TO-247 package: 1. Source (S) 2. Gate (G) 3. Drain (D)
The IXFH120N20P operates based on the principle of field-effect transistors, where the voltage applied to the gate terminal controls the flow of current between the source and drain terminals. By modulating the gate-source voltage, the device can efficiently regulate power flow in electronic circuits.
The IXFH120N20P finds extensive use in the following application fields: - Switched Mode Power Supplies (SMPS) - Motor Control Systems - Renewable Energy Systems - Electric Vehicle Powertrains - Industrial Automation Equipment
